Competitive site analysis

Competitive site analysis is the study of the strengths and weaknesses of competitors' websites in order to identify their SEO, content, and marketing strategies. The goal is to use the data obtained to improve positions and attract an audience.

Competitive website analysis service

01
Competitive analysis of a website includes studying competitors' positions on key queries, analyzing their content and keyword usage strategies. It is important to evaluate their link strategy, the quality of external links, and the pages with the most traffic. You should also analyze the user experience on their sites, including mobile adaptability and download speed. Additionally, it is necessary to study what technical and SEO methods competitors use to increase visibility in search engines.

What does competitive analysis include?
Competitive analysis includes the study of competitors' strategies in SEO, content, advertising and promotion. Their strengths and weaknesses, keywords, website design and functionality are evaluated. This helps you identify growth points, develop an effective strategy, and improve your business' position.

How long does it take to conduct a competitive site analysis?
Conducting a competitive analysis of a website takes from a few days to two weeks, depending on the number of competitors and the depth of the research. 2-3 days is enough for a small analysis, while a detailed study may take longer. The results are presented in the form of a report with recommendations for improving the strategy.
